Market Overview
The Marine Scrubber Systems Sales Market is a segment of the marine pollution control industry that focuses on the sale of scrubber systems for ships. Marine scrubber systems are used to remove pollutants from ship exhaust gases, such as sulfur oxides (SOx) and particulate matter. The market is driven by regulations aimed at reducing emissions from ships, such as the International Maritime Organization’s (IMO) sulfur cap regulations, which require ships to use fuel with a sulfur content of no more than 0.50% m/m.
Meaning
Marine scrubber systems are pollution control devices used to remove pollutants from ship exhaust gases. They work by spraying alkaline water or other solutions into the exhaust stream, which reacts with and removes pollutants such as sulfur oxides (SOx) and particulate matter. Marine scrubber systems are used to comply with emissions regulations and reduce the environmental impact of shipping.

Market Drivers
- Regulatory Compliance: Regulations such as the IMO sulfur cap require ships to reduce their emissions, driving the adoption of marine scrubber systems.
- Environmental Concerns: Increasing awareness of the environmental impact of shipping is driving demand for cleaner technologies such as marine scrubber systems.
- Cost Savings: Marine scrubber systems can help reduce fuel costs by allowing ships to use lower-cost, higher-sulfur fuels while still complying with emissions regulations.
- Operational Flexibility: Scrubber systems provide ships with the flexibility to operate in areas where low-sulfur fuels may be unavailable or expensive.

Category-wise Insights
- Open Loop Scrubbers: Open loop scrubbers use seawater to remove pollutants from exhaust gases, making them a cost-effective solution for many ships.
- Closed Loop Scrubbers: Closed loop scrubbers use a closed-loop system with an alkaline solution to remove pollutants, making them suitable for ships operating in sensitive areas.
- Hybrid Scrubbers: Hybrid scrubbers combine features of both open and closed loop systems, offering flexibility and efficiency.
